Output 908c5066f4ba694c39a1ce31b96f725ddf80d788ea5fa2124410fc7723e196c8:0

value
2931774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c30deef75f969df6f45654b2f20b13d329b0f546 OP_EQUAL
address
3KUNP4hb2Q614bLas9Ys1sfqqiu5ZFcLiw
transaction
908c5066f4ba694c39a1ce31b96f725ddf80d788ea5fa2124410fc7723e196c8
spent
true